grossmj
|
7f72b90b0e
|
The server has now 2 notification streams
* A new one for controller related events (compute, appliance templates etc.)
* The existing one for project related events (links, nodes etc.)
|
6 years ago |
grossmj
|
033f005bde
|
Merge branch '2.1' into 2.2
# Conflicts:
# gns3server/compute/docker/docker_vm.py
# gns3server/version.py
|
6 years ago |
ziajka
|
41026c74c1
|
Use mocked dir for web-ui redirection test
|
6 years ago |
ziajka
|
7d75b6248d
|
Use mocked dir of web-ui for tests
|
6 years ago |
ziajka
|
0e1f2e26d0
|
Serve WebUI handlers and update-bundled-web-ui script, Ref: #1362
|
6 years ago |
ziajka
|
867e997b74
|
Support /static/ files serving, Ref: #1362
|
6 years ago |
grossmj
|
0f496907a0
|
Fix API status code for start/stop/suspend/reload a node. Fixes #1353.
Fix issues with test.
Update documentation.
|
6 years ago |
ziajka
|
ac73c72727
|
Don't send variables to computes where are empty, Ref: #1340
|
6 years ago |
grossmj
|
d1ccf3bc84
|
Merge branch '2.1' into 2.2
# Conflicts:
# gns3server/version.py
# requirements.txt
|
6 years ago |
ziajka
|
7b3d5ae5e3
|
Create/update project on compute when variables changes
|
6 years ago |
ziajka
|
f2700ed445
|
Support of supplier and variables in topology
|
6 years ago |
ziajka
|
132c7c8f5b
|
Fix tests
|
6 years ago |
ziajka
|
e267f8a8b8
|
Project global variables
|
6 years ago |
ziajka
|
43081152ef
|
Add support of ExtraHosts for Docker, Ref. gns3-gui#2482
|
6 years ago |
grossmj
|
64949f5d04
|
Fix bug with 'none' console type for Ethernet switch.
Fix some tests related to traceng.
|
7 years ago |
grossmj
|
669d2ec038
|
Merge branch '2.1' into 2.2
# Conflicts:
# gns3server/schemas/node.py
|
7 years ago |
grossmj
|
297bbd91ec
|
Fix traceng tests.
|
7 years ago |
grossmj
|
d08c08617c
|
Support for source and destination for traceNG.
|
7 years ago |
grossmj
|
397c1322b4
|
Base support for TraceNG.
|
7 years ago |
ziajka
|
d9a0ec9ff3
|
Replace asyncio.async with ensure_future because of deprecation, Fixes: #1269
|
7 years ago |
grossmj
|
2e40fb8608
|
Fix client/server version test.
|
7 years ago |
Bernhard Ehlers
|
8907b3d58a
|
GNS3-API: implement GET for specific drawing and link
Fixes #1249
|
7 years ago |
grossmj
|
851fcf5c71
|
Fix compute auto idlepc test.
|
7 years ago |
grossmj
|
cf14deb2fa
|
Fix IOU tests.
|
7 years ago |
ziajka
|
b654d78ea6
|
Endpoint for obtaining direct action on compute
|
7 years ago |
Dominik Ziajka
|
be35ad6874
|
Fixes path normalization during file upload on nodes (Fixes: #2276)
|
7 years ago |
Julien Duponchelle
|
92c9e48f18
|
This fix the images always included in portable project
Also add test to avoid regressions on this.
Fix https://github.com/GNS3/gns3-gui/issues/2165
|
7 years ago |
Jeremy Grossmann
|
bb90c0ba52
|
Merge pull request #1140 from GNS3/duplicate_docker
Support duplicate for Docker
|
7 years ago |
Jeremy Grossmann
|
a805b3c7c3
|
Merge pull request #1142 from GNS3/duplicate_iou
Duplicate IOU
|
7 years ago |
Julien Duponchelle
|
6d4529f445
|
Duplicate IOU
Ref https://github.com/GNS3/gns3-gui/issues/1065
|
7 years ago |
Julien Duponchelle
|
16209a2b60
|
Support duplicate for Docker
Ref https://github.com/GNS3/gns3-gui/issues/1065
|
7 years ago |
Julien Duponchelle
|
01be1b32c4
|
Duplicate support for qemu
Ref https://github.com/GNS3/gns3-gui/issues/1065
|
7 years ago |
Julien Duponchelle
|
0854c04687
|
API for duplication a Node
Support:
* VPCS
* Dynamips router
* Ethernet switch
Ref #1065
|
7 years ago |
Julien Duponchelle
|
5fd842e54d
|
Suspend link
|
7 years ago |
Julien Duponchelle
|
bce9c61e41
|
Cleanup unused code in test_link
|
7 years ago |
Jeremy Grossmann
|
c2fbe4f313
|
Merge pull request #1130 from GNS3/vmware_filters
Filters support for VMware
|
7 years ago |
Jeremy Grossmann
|
ac10ba370a
|
Merge pull request #1129 from GNS3/filters_virtualbox
Packet filters support for VirtualBox
|
7 years ago |
Julien Duponchelle
|
fa211a82eb
|
Filters support for VMware
Fix #1108
|
7 years ago |
Julien Duponchelle
|
d9b13fb0c5
|
Add test for the VMware compute API
|
7 years ago |
Julien Duponchelle
|
54faaf5f6f
|
Packet filters support for VirtualBox
Fix #1107
|
7 years ago |
Julien Duponchelle
|
08d4c1a000
|
Merge branch '2.1' into filters_iou
|
7 years ago |
Julien Duponchelle
|
536c708c16
|
Filter implementation for cloud & Nat
Fix #1111
|
7 years ago |
Julien Duponchelle
|
5b839c22e9
|
Filters support for IOU
Fix #1113
|
7 years ago |
Julien Duponchelle
|
23c3d32e06
|
Filter support for Docker
Fix #1110
|
7 years ago |
Julien Duponchelle
|
03f8c747cc
|
Qemu support for packet filtering
Fix #1112
|
7 years ago |
Julien Duponchelle
|
9e2759a3f2
|
Merge branch '2.1' into remove_use_ubrige
|
7 years ago |
Julien Duponchelle
|
fd0770158c
|
Fix tests with Yarl 0.11
|
7 years ago |
Julien Duponchelle
|
d112da400e
|
Remove use_ubridge flag
Ref #1115
|
7 years ago |
Julien Duponchelle
|
c6f28afb7c
|
Fix a broken test
|
7 years ago |
Jeremy Grossmann
|
339ed8ab57
|
Merge pull request #1106 from GNS3/idlepc_apicall
Implement an api call for computing the IDLE PC
|
7 years ago |
Julien Duponchelle
|
3eadbb9adb
|
Implement an api call for computing the IDLE PC
Fix https://github.com/GNS3/gns3-gui/pull/2153
|
7 years ago |
Julien Duponchelle
|
08423eff96
|
Support packet filtering for VPCS
https://github.com/GNS3/gns3-gui/issues/765
|
7 years ago |
Julien Duponchelle
|
a8e8eac0b4
|
Merge remote-tracking branch 'origin/master' into 2.1
|
7 years ago |
ziajka
|
ea9f0e52c8
|
Fixes #2108 (gns3-gui): getting project file with leading slashes issue (#1078)
|
7 years ago |
Julien Duponchelle
|
bb8097a052
|
Merge remote-tracking branch 'origin/master' into 2.1
|
7 years ago |
Julien Duponchelle
|
c1c3a9ed80
|
Drop debug
|
7 years ago |
Julien Duponchelle
|
189ad994c8
|
Symbols are returned with a content length
|
7 years ago |
Julien Duponchelle
|
a4245fcf44
|
Aiohttp 2.0
Ref #1000
|
7 years ago |
Julien Duponchelle
|
b0f45035a9
|
NAT node can use the VMware NAT
On Windows and Mac OS this allow the NAT node to use the
VMware nat (it's always vmnet8). On Linux we still use the
libvirt NAT
|
8 years ago |
Julien Duponchelle
|
273a711459
|
Merge branch '2.0' into 2.1
|
8 years ago |
Julien Duponchelle
|
36de30e25e
|
Fix various tests for windows
|
8 years ago |
Julien Duponchelle
|
9dc6f0f486
|
Embed the appliances in the server. (#927)
This add a /appliances call
|
8 years ago |
Julien Duponchelle
|
4f1b738ef5
|
Merge branch '2.0' into 2.1
|
8 years ago |
Julien Duponchelle
|
cc6f4c0510
|
Add a modification uuid to settings returned by the server
Ref #1949
|
8 years ago |
Julien Duponchelle
|
6017ebbd97
|
Merge branch '2.0' into 2.1
|
8 years ago |
Julien Duponchelle
|
54131bc9bb
|
Update the documentation
|
8 years ago |
Julien Duponchelle
|
5a399b90fe
|
Merge branch '2.1' into embed_appliances
|
8 years ago |
Julien Duponchelle
|
8d86d959de
|
"/appliances" => "/appliances/templates"
|
8 years ago |
Julien Duponchelle
|
e892e5dfab
|
Manage base configuration on server
Fix #786
|
8 years ago |
Julien Duponchelle
|
dc6756d5ae
|
Embed the appliances in the server.
This add a /appliances call
|
8 years ago |
Julien Duponchelle
|
6938e400d1
|
Fix VPCS test suite
|
8 years ago |
Julien Duponchelle
|
2de284ea30
|
Fix some tests on travis
|
8 years ago |
Julien Duponchelle
|
82c99418b4
|
Fix If cloud interface is down the project doesn't open
Fix https://github.com/GNS3/gns3-gui/issues/1751
|
8 years ago |
Julien Duponchelle
|
2011aca43a
|
Fix an issue with Docker and IOU packet capture
Fix https://github.com/GNS3/gns3-gui/issues/1727
|
8 years ago |
Julien Duponchelle
|
49315adf79
|
Do not recurse scan for images in standard image directory
Fix https://github.com/GNS3/gns3-gui/issues/1680
|
8 years ago |
Julien Duponchelle
|
794dac31f5
|
UDP tunnel debuging
Fix #1562
|
8 years ago |
Julien Duponchelle
|
8ad5670eeb
|
For security reason debug informations can only be exported from local server
Ref #1562
|
8 years ago |
Julien Duponchelle
|
a14ad2fc99
|
Fix tests
|
8 years ago |
Julien Duponchelle
|
7c1a079ee8
|
Add a test for unicode characters in /images
Ref #756
|
8 years ago |
Julien Duponchelle
|
4fe293f1d5
|
Fix tests crash on travis
|
8 years ago |
Julien Duponchelle
|
4815904737
|
/debug for exporting debug informations
Ref #740, https://github.com/GNS3/gns3-gui/issues/1562
|
8 years ago |
Julien Duponchelle
|
106915f419
|
Return md5sum and filesize in the list of images
Ref https://github.com/GNS3/gns3-gui/issues/1590
|
8 years ago |
Julien Duponchelle
|
69fcf801c3
|
Update api documentations
|
8 years ago |
Julien Duponchelle
|
4b4053dc2b
|
Return the platform of a compute
Ref https://github.com/GNS3/gns3-gui/issues/1550
|
8 years ago |
Julien Duponchelle
|
99bdf37ec3
|
Prevent connect a node to himself
Fix https://github.com/GNS3/gns3-gui/issues/1553
|
8 years ago |
Julien Duponchelle
|
fb2dac6ef1
|
All tests pass on windows
|
8 years ago |
Julien Duponchelle
|
79b4926cad
|
Fix the nat node
Ref #686
|
8 years ago |
Julien Duponchelle
|
77eae35778
|
API method for getting a node
|
8 years ago |
Julien Duponchelle
|
da5e3d0e54
|
Dissallow serial to ethernet connection
Fix #678
|
8 years ago |
Julien Duponchelle
|
f1fe7246e7
|
Remove --controller
This add too much complexity and it can work
without it.
Fix https://github.com/GNS3/gns3-vm/issues/80, #645
|
8 years ago |
Julien Duponchelle
|
9c6ee97ff2
|
Fix tests on Travis
|
8 years ago |
Julien Duponchelle
|
be0fee99e7
|
Test pcap streaming
|
8 years ago |
Julien Duponchelle
|
36d2e80d0a
|
Nat node is only on the GNS3 VM for the moment
Fix https://github.com/GNS3/gns3-gui/issues/1448
|
8 years ago |
Julien Duponchelle
|
bbc1505274
|
Return what is supported by a compute node
Ref https://github.com/GNS3/gns3-gui/issues/1448
|
8 years ago |
Julien Duponchelle
|
19e6d956df
|
Drop unused endpoint POST /version on compute
|
8 years ago |
Julien Duponchelle
|
21b99ad9f9
|
Support for sendings settings for the GNS3VM from the GUI
Ref https://github.com/GNS3/gns3-gui/issues/1441
|
8 years ago |
Julien Duponchelle
|
bfabf3ddc8
|
Fix tests about local compute node
|
8 years ago |
Julien Duponchelle
|
9231b8e991
|
Fix Exception when opening project that contains an IOU node
Fix #636
|
8 years ago |
Julien Duponchelle
|
cde28c849e
|
Return status when you start / stop / suspend a node
Should avoid sync issues
|
8 years ago |
Julien Duponchelle
|
a53a972135
|
Nat node for only the GNS3 VM
|
8 years ago |